欢迎来到天天文库
浏览记录
ID:52927541
大小:2.01 MB
页数:16页
时间:2020-04-01
《游戏机中的运动捕捉.pptx》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、我动,你就动——游戏机中的运动捕捉FC红白机光枪的工作原理很简单,这归功于FC游戏厂商的巧妙设计。首先我们先来认识FC的光枪FC的光枪有三个关键部分:第一个是枪头,它的内部有有感光芯片;第二个是光枪上唯一的按钮,就是扳机,在游戏的过程中,瞄准的同时需要按下扳机进行射击。第三个是接头。光枪游戏就通过检测扳机的状态以及检测到的光的强弱来判断玩家是否击中了目标。典型的,白光是强的,黑色就是弱的。这里以《打鸭子DUCKHUNT》为例,游戏正常的情况下如图1所示,图中有两只鸭子。当玩家按下扳机,游戏画面会
2、变黑,如图2所示。这个画面的切换比较快,大概在30ms左右。这屏幕变黑的这段时间中,游戏可以检测光枪返回的光枪,看是否为弱。之后,第一只鸭子的位置会用白色块显示,如图3所示,从图2到图3在30ms左右。如果这个时候游戏发现检测到的光强很强,那就说明玩家击中这只鸭子了。大概过50ms左右,画面会切换到图4,白色块显示在第二只鸭子的地方,如果游戏此时发现光强为强,那么就说明玩家击中第二只鸭子了。再过50ms左右,游戏会返回到正常画面。以上就是光枪的工作过程了。Wii是日本任天堂公司(nintendo)20
3、06年11月19日所推出的第5代家用游戏主机任天堂Wii系统,包含主机,专用感应器和左手控制器NunChuck、右手控制器WiiRemote,也就是国内俗称的“双节棍手柄”,一左一右遥控器都内置了3轴重力加速度传感器,通过蓝牙与主机通信。无线和动作感应是Wii系统提供了一种直观而自然的游戏操作方式。通过双手挥动左右手柄,可以面对银幕,感受拳击,网球甚至驾驶飞机的感受。Wii遥控器是任天堂游戏主机Wii的主要控制器(摇杆)。Wii遥控器的外型为棒状,就如同电视遥控器一样,可单手操作。除了像一般遥控器可以
4、用按钮来控制,它还有两项功能:指向定位及动作感应。前者就如同光线枪或滑鼠一般可以控制萤幕上的游标,后者可侦测三维空间当中的移动及旋转,结合两者可以达成所谓的“体感操作”。玩者可以透过移动和指向来与电视萤幕上的虚拟物件产生互动,此外也可借由连接扩充设备延伸控制器的功能。Xbox360是世界最大的电脑软件公司微软所开发的第二代家用视频游戏主机。它的一个外设使得人们可以抛弃游戏手柄,站在屏幕的前面,用肢体动作控制着游戏中的角色。这个外设就是Kinect。Kinect骨架追踪处理流程的核心是一个无论周围环境的
5、光照条件如何,都可以让Kinect感知世界的CMOS红外传感器。该传感器通过黑白光谱的方式来感知环境:纯黑代表无穷远,纯白代表无穷近。黑白间的灰色地带对应物体到传感器的物理距离。它收集视野范围内的每一点,并形成一幅代表周围环境的景深图像。传感器以每秒30帧的速度生成景深图像流,实时3D地再现周围环境。Kinect需要做的下一件事是寻找图像中较可能是人体的移动物体,就像人眼下意识地聚焦在移动物体上那样。接下来,Kinect会对景深图像进行像素级评估,来辨别人体的不同部位。同时,这一过程必须以优化的预处理
6、来缩短响应时间。接下来,分割化玩家图像的每一个像素都被传送进一个辨别人体部位的机器学习系统中。随后该系统将给出了某个特定像素属于哪个身体部位的可能性。这一系统被称为Exemplar(模型)系统。处理流程的最后一步是使用之前阶段输出的结果,根据追踪到的20个关节点来生成一幅骨架系统。Kinect会评估Exemplar输出的每一个可能的像素来确定关节点。通过这种方式Kinect能够基于充分的信息最准确地评估人体实际所处位置。
此文档下载收益归作者所有